• CornedDefinition & Meaning in English

  1. (imp. & p. p.) of Corn

• CornDefinition & Meaning in English

  1. (v. t.) To feed with corn or (in Sctland) oats; as, to corn horses.
  2. (n.) A single seed of certain plants, as wheat, rye, barley, and maize; a grain.
  3. (n.) A thickening of the epidermis at some point, esp. on the toes, by friction or pressure. It is usually painful and troublesome.
  4. (v. t.) To render intoxicated; as, ale strong enough to corn one.
  5. (n.) The plants which produce corn, when growing in the field; the stalks and ears, or the stalks, ears, and seeds, after reaping and before thrashing.
  6. (n.) A small, hard particle; a grain.
  7. (n.) The various farinaceous grains of the cereal grasses used for food, as wheat, rye, barley, maize, oats.
  8. (v. t.) To form into small grains; to granulate; as, to corn gunpowder.
  9. (v. t.) To preserve and season with salt in grains; to sprinkle with salt; to cure by salting; now, specifically, to salt slightly in brine or otherwise; as, to corn beef; to corn a tongue.
